Start with a volt meter and make sure the charger (converter) is charging the system and how much it is putting back into the batteries on shore power. Then, check to see what the drain is on the batteries. There will be a small amount of power used to run the detectors and maybe the refrigerator with all else mostly shut off. If you are getting good charging at or around 14.2 +/- volts then look for excessive drain on the batteries. One by one eliminate the source of the drain. Often this can be done by pulling the fuse to that drain appliance.
